I’m Laura Quiñonez, ASW #112176, a Certified Trauma Professional and Associate Clinical Social Worker dedicated to providing trauma-informed and culturally responsive care. I work with adults and families navigating trauma, anxiety, depression, grief, and relational challenges. My practice also centers on supporting LGBTQIA2+ individuals, allies, and those from rural or underserved communities, where access to mental health care can often feel limited. My therapeutic style is grounded in warmth, authenticity, and collaboration. I integrate evidence-based practices such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) with mindfulness and somatic approaches. Together, these tools support clients in reconnecting with their bodies, finding balance, and building resilience. I believe that therapy is not about “fixing” you, but about creating a safe and empowering space to explore your story, honor your strengths, and move toward healing at your own pace. I hold both a Bachelor’s and Master’s degree in Social Work, with specialized training in trauma treatment. My work has been shaped by years of clinical and community practice along the rural Northern California coast, where I’ve witnessed the importance of accessible, compassionate, and holistic mental health care. Through Gaia Therapy Center, I carry forward the philosophy that healing begins when we are rooted in presence and supported in growth.
